  SERP, which stands for search engine result page , refers to the content that search engines like Google display when someone searches for something online. It’s critical to understand how SERP rankings work and why it’s in your best interest to pay attention to them. In this guide, you’ll learn what SERPs are and how they work, as well as some of the ways you can benefit from them as an online marketer. Let’s get started! The Search Engine Results Page (SERP) A search engine results page (SERP) is what you see when you search on Google or Bing. The results of your search are displayed in order of importance based on how relevant those websites are to your query. The first item in any SERP is always deemed to be most important, followed by subsequent items that have been determined less relevant by ranking algorithms.  The practice of optimizing individual web pages to rank higher and earn more relevant traffic in search engines is known as on-page SEO, which stands in contrast to off-page SEO which refers to links and other external signals. On-page optimization should be part of any successful SEO strategy , as it consists of changes that can be made directly to your site. The following are 7 on-page SEO hacks you can use today to immediately boost your rankings in search engines such as Google and Bing. What is on-page SEO? SEO , or search engine optimization, refers to practices designed to improve a web page's rank in search engines such as Google. SEO can be broken down into two categories: on-page and off-page .  On-page SEO refers to any technique that focuses on changes you make within your website.
